引言
在数字化时代,原型设计已成为产品开发的重要环节。Axure RP是一款功能强大的原型设计工具,它提供了丰富的交互功能,可以帮助设计师创建出更加生动、逼真的原型。本文将深入探讨Axure的联动交互功能,揭示其在高效原型设计中的应用奥秘。
一、Axure联动交互概述
1.1 联动交互的定义
联动交互是指在原型设计中,通过设置触发条件,使得一个元素(如按钮、文本框等)的操作影响到另一个元素的状态或行为。
1.2 联动交互的作用
联动交互能够提升原型的交互性和生动性,让用户在操作过程中有更直观的体验,有助于发现设计中的问题,提高设计质量。
二、Axure联动交互的类型
2.1 基本联动
基本联动是指简单的联动效果,如点击按钮切换页面、显示或隐藏元素等。
2.2 高级联动
高级联动包括触发条件更加复杂、联动效果更加丰富的交互,如动态面板、状态机、变量等。
三、Axure联动交互的应用实例
3.1 动态面板
动态面板是Axure中的一种强大组件,可以用来创建复杂的联动效果。
示例代码:
<DynamicPanel>
<Text>欢迎来到我们的网站!</Text>
<Button>点击进入</Button>
</DynamicPanel>
当用户点击按钮时,动态面板会切换到下一个状态,显示不同的内容。
3.2 状态机
状态机可以用来控制元素的多个状态,实现复杂的联动效果。
示例代码:
<States>
<State label="正常">
<Button>点击切换</Button>
</State>
<State label="禁用">
<Button disabled>点击切换</Button>
</State>
</States>
当用户点击按钮时,状态机会切换到下一个状态,改变按钮的禁用状态。
3.3 变量
变量可以用来存储和传递数据,实现复杂的联动效果。
示例代码:
<Variable name="count" value="0">
<Button>增加</Button>
<Text>当前数量:${count}</Text>
</Variable>
当用户点击按钮时,变量count会增加,并实时显示在页面上。
四、总结
Axure的联动交互功能为设计师提供了丰富的可能性,有助于提升原型的交互性和生动性。通过本文的介绍,相信您已经对Axure联动交互有了更深入的了解。在实际应用中,结合具体需求,灵活运用这些功能,定能让您的原型设计更加出色!
